Output 74e3c08f61abb377634a3aa052eef77d67ee5bbe8bc909d785bd01e25efed65f:1

value
4899753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48cc42837811cecbc42b9a80497b0f849af42d35 OP_EQUALVERIFY OP_CHECKSIG
address
17dvM2uJiddLFhGxdvuM48WuiwFatPaWKo
transaction
74e3c08f61abb377634a3aa052eef77d67ee5bbe8bc909d785bd01e25efed65f
confirmations
367250
spent
true